Description

Offers interpreting and translating services are available for a fee for courts, hospitals, law enforcement agencies, health care providers, and other local organizations through a Language Bank of about 100 paid interpreters with a total of 54 languages. After hours interpreters are provided ONLY for life threatening situations such as hospital or medical emergencies, car accidents, domestic violence, and rape crisis. After hours interpreters ARE NOT provided for DUI, hospital discharge (unless scheduled in advance), private individuals, or other similar circumstances.

Providing organization

International Institute Of Akron

Serves as the refugee resettlement program for Summit County and outlying areas. Offers airport pickup, case management, and initial financial assistance with a goal of rapid self-sufficiency. Provides immigration counseling, translating and interpreting services, and English for Speakers of Other Languages. Serves as the primary local resource for immigration matters.
